Output 8ae8800576d1e14a6c4d773c409d84d5a85984056701e635e8c8635e7a8421fd:15

value
151462967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cba660f7ab568a08ad314331770da12ca390e8a2 OP_EQUAL
address
3LFpQgiW2ZXcDusxQwemP1uVH79s5vpj84
transaction
8ae8800576d1e14a6c4d773c409d84d5a85984056701e635e8c8635e7a8421fd
spent
true